Average rent in Tucson, Arizona

The average rent for a 1 bedroom apartment in Tucson is $1,022+, while the average rent for a 2 bedroom apartment is $1,314+. Rent rates updated 8 days ago
Studio
$908+
Prices trending down
1 Bed
$1,022+
Prices trending down
2 Beds
$1,314+
Prices trending down
3+ Beds
$1,614+
Prices trending down
* Averages are based on the rental prices of properties listed on Apartment List that don’t include fees

Top neighborhoods

Top neighborhoods in Tucson, AZ

  • Map of West University

    West University

    What's it like to live in West University?

    Academic professionals choose West University for its perfect blend of craftsman bungalows and adobe architecture walking distance to University of Arizona. The neighborhood's historic district designation preserves architectural character while preventing overdevelopment that plagues other university-adjacent communities. Unlike undergraduate-dominated areas, you'll find streets quiet enough for research and writing requiring focused concentration.

  • Map of Palo Verde

    Palo Verde

    What's it like to live in Palo Verde?

    Eco-conscious living circles Palo Verde Park’s xeriscaped gardens. Renters prize solar-paneled units but face strict water restrictions limiting lawn irrigation. Monsoon floods test drainage systems.

  • Map of Midvale Park

    Midvale Park

    What's it like to live in Midvale Park?

    Affordable sprawl attracts first-timers to this grid of 1980s stucco homes. The catch? Scorpion infestations in garages and 45-minute drives to University of Arizona jobs.

Tucson Rent Report: June 2026

Welcome to the Apartment List June 2026 Rent Report for Tucson, AZ. Currently, the overall median rent in the city stands at $1,030, roughly the same as last month. Prices remain down 2.8% year-over-year. Read on to learn more about what’s been happening in the Tucson rental market and how it compares to trends throughout the nation as a whole.

Tucson Renter Confidence Survey

National study of renter’s satisfaction with their cities and states

Here’s how Tucson ranks on:


Overview of Findings

Apartment List has released Tucson’s results from the third annual Apartment List Renter Satisfaction Survey. This survey, which drew on responses from over 45,000 renters nationwide, provides insight on what states and cities must do to meet the needs of the country’s 111 million renters.

"Tucson renters expressed general dissatisfaction with the city overall," according to Apartment List. "They gave most categories average scores."

Key Findings in Tucson include the following:

  • Tucson renters gave their city a D overall.
  • The highest-rated categories for Tucson were affordability and social life, which received A+ and B+ grades, respectively.
  • The areas of concern to Tucson renters are safety and low crime, jobs and career opportunities, and recreational activities, which all received scores of C+.
  • Tucson millennials are unsatisfied with their city, giving it an overall rating of D.
  • Tucson did relatively poorly compared to other cities in Arizona, including Mesa (C+), Phoenix (B-) and Scottsdale (A+).
  • Tucson did relatively poorly compared to similar cities nationwide, including Albuquerque (C), Kansas City (B) and Raleigh (A).
  • The top rated cities nationwide for renter satisfaction include Scottsdale, AZ, Irvine, CA, Boulder, CO and Ann Arbor, MI. The lowest rated cities include Tallahassee, FL, Stockton, CA, Dayton, OH, Detroit, MI and Newark, NJ.

Renters say:

  • "I love the weather and mountain views." - Jessica L.
  • "Tucson is gorgeous and affordable. It has a small town charm but with more culture and activities than an actual small town." -Kenzie B.
  • "It’s a beautiful place, but economically, it could be much better." -Anon.
